Sebastian Kurz to open conference in Budva

Sebastian Kurz to open conference in Budva

 

Austrian Chancellor Sebastian Kurz and the President of Montenegro Milo Đukanović, along with the president of the Chamber of Commerce Vlastimir Golubović, will open a two-day conference on economy, which will take place in Budva on 25-26 October.

Prime minister Duško Marković, Edi Rama, Ramuš Haradinaj, Vjekoslav Bevanda, Kočo Anđušev and Rasim Ljajić, will speak on the conference main topic “the Western Balkans and the European Union – a five-year cycle of the Berlin process”, aiming to provide important answers for economic future of the region.

The Chamber of Commerce of Montenegro, PKCG, says 600 participants will attend the conference, while the panelists will be economy ministers from the region, representatives of the international financial institutions and investors, presidents of chambers as well as the representatives of highly successful companies running business in the Balkans.
